In addition to the FPV camera and transmitter, the FPV antenna plays a vital function in the overall system, impacting the quality and variety of the video transmission. The selection of antennas, whether they are directional or omnidirectional, can substantially affect the dependability of the video link. Omnidirectional antennas, which transfer and receive signals in all instructions, are valuable for keeping a steady connection in scenarios where the drone might alter direction regularly. Alternatively, directional antennas are created to focus the signal in a specific instructions, which can substantially enhance array however need the antenna to be sharp in the direction of the drone. Combining various kinds of antennas on the transmitter and receiver (a setup frequently described as antenna diversity) can offer better versatility and performance, decreasing the danger of signal loss throughout trip.

Drone antennas are important to the efficiency of both the transmitter and receiver systems. Top notch FPV antennas are developed to efficiently transmit and obtain radio signals, which directly impacts the quality and array of the video feed. The material and design of the antenna, such as whether it is a circular or linear polarized antenna, can affect efficiency. Circular polarized antennas are particularly preferred in FPV systems because of their better efficiency in alleviating multipath interference, which takes place when signals jump off surfaces and develop ghosting impacts in the video feed. Guaranteeing that the drone's antenna system is maximized for the details atmosphere and flight needs is essential to achieving a top notch and trustworthy video link.
